Be Generous with Your Compliments


Compliments are like glue to a relationship. It is one of the most basic human needs. Everyone wants to be recognized, appreciated and complimented for their efforts no matter how big or small they are.

In the work environment, compliment your employees or associates for the great job on a certain project. When we compliment people openly, we empower them to rise to the top of their caliber. Learn to give compliment without any strings attached. Resist the urge to mix criticism with compliments. People perform better when we show our confidence in them through sincere praise.

In the home front, it is easy to overlook the services and sacrifices of our loved ones. Do not make the grave mistake of taking them for granted. Without their understanding, support and sacrifices you would not be where you are. Do they know you appreciate them? Compliment them verbally. Write notes. Give cards, chocolate, roses or do whatever you can to show your appreciation.

One of the most empowering things you can do for yourself is to compliment yourself. This is very hard for performance-minded people. Yes, there is always going to be a better, more efficient way of doing things. But you have got to develop a healthy habit of complimenting yourself. Even God congratulated Himself after creation and said, “It was good.”

Compliment others without flattery and your life will be like a blooming garden of flowers!
